This is what the Lord says:
(A)Cursed is the man who trusts in mankind
And makes (B)flesh his [a]strength,
And whose heart turns away from the Lord.
For he will be like a (C)bush in the desert,
And will not see when prosperity comes,
But will live in stony wastes in the wilderness,
A (D)land of salt that is not inhabited.
(E)Blessed is the man who trusts in the Lord,
And whose (F)trust is the Lord.
For he will be like a (G)tree planted by the water
That extends its roots by a stream,
And does not fear when the heat comes;
But its leaves will be green,
And it will not be anxious in a year of (H)drought,
Nor cease to yield fruit.

Wisdom from the Lord

This is what the Lord says:
“Cursed are those who put their trust in mere humans,
    who rely on human strength
    and turn their hearts away from the Lord.
They are like stunted shrubs in the desert,
    with no hope for the future.
They will live in the barren wilderness,
    in an uninhabited salty land.

“But blessed are those who trust in the Lord
    and have made the Lord their hope and confidence.
They are like trees planted along a riverbank,
    with roots that reach deep into the water.
Such trees are not bothered by the heat
    or worried by long months of drought.
Their leaves stay green,
    and they never stop producing fruit.
